Definition of planer - Reverso English Dictionary
Noun
1.
woodworkingRare tool for smoothing wood surfacesRare
- He used a planer to smooth the tabletop.
2.
metalworkTECH. machine for cutting flat metal surfacesTECH.
- The planer shaped the metal into a flat sheet.
3.
printingDated flat wood piece for leveling typeDated
- He used a planer to level the type in the chase.

Definition of plane - Reverso English Dictionary
Noun
1.
aviationaircraft designed for flight
- The plane took off at dawn..
2.
mathematicsTECH. flat, level surfaceTECH.
- The table's top is a perfect plane..
3.
plantRare large tree with broad leavesRare
- The plane tree provided ample shade in the park.
4.
carpentryRare tool for smoothing woodRare
- He used a plane to smooth the table's surface..
5.
existenceRare level of existence or developmentRare
- Her thoughts were on a different plane of understanding.
Verb
1.
aviationintr. glide or soar through the airintr.
- The bird planed effortlessly in the sky.
2.
woodworkingtr. smooth wood surfaces using a hand tool with a sharp bladetr.
- He planed the wooden board to achieve a smooth surface..
3.
maritimeintr. Rare move quickly across water surfaceintr. Rare
- The speedboat planed across the lake.
Adjective
1.
level surfacecompletely level or flat
- The carpenter ensured the board was plane before cutting..
2.
mathematicsTECH. lying entirely on a single flat surfaceTECH.
- The shape is a plane figure.
